Main Features
In 1985, Korg’s DW-8000 combined digital wavetables with rich analog filters to give users sounds which were
impossible to create with analog oscillators. It’s still a cult favorite today.
The modwave builds on the DW legacy and transforms it into a modern monster synth, featuring incredibly deep
wavetable oscillators, gorgeous filters, wildly flexible modulation, sophisticated pattern sequencing, and macro controls
to deliver unique, powerful, and easily customizable sounds and phrases.
Wavetable Oscillators
Start with over 200 wavetables, each containing up to 64 waveforms—from thousands of individual waves. Use the 30+
Modifiers to change their basic character, and the 13 Morph Types to process them in real-time. Create new hybrids
from any two wavetables using the unique, realtime A/B Blend.
Expand your palette even more by importing new wavetables using the Editor/Librarian software. Try the many free
and commercial wavetable libraries in the standard Serum format*, or create your own using the custom modwave
version of the free, cross-platform WaveEdit. Layer wavetables with samples from the built-in, multi-gigabyte PCM
library, or import your own samples using Korg’s free Sample Builder software.
Kaoss Physics and Motion Sequencing 2.0
modwave also introduces two unique new tools for creating dynamic motion: Kaoss Physics and Motion Sequencing
2.0. Kaoss Physics combines an x/y Kaoss pad with modulatable game physics to create a responsive, interactive
controller that is—besides being powerful— a lot of fun to explore. Motion Sequencing 2.0 brings the organic,
continuously evolving patterns of the wavestate’s Wave Sequencing 2.0 into the world of motion sequencing, including
multiple lanes, asynchronous loops, step probability, and more.
Filters
Add vintage character to your sounds with the aggressive MS-20 Lowpass or Highpass filters, or the strong, sweet
Polysix Lowpass. Shape and refine with a full collection of resonant 2-pole and 4-pole Lowpass, Highpass, Bandpass,
and Band Reject filters. Or, step outside the box with Korg’s unique Multi Filter, which creates modulatable blends of
multiple modes simultaneously.
Modulation
Most parameters can be modulated, with up to 2,000 modulation destinations per Performance, and no fixed limit on
the total number of modulation routings. You can even modulate settings for individual Motion Sequence Steps!
Mod Knobs put macro transformations under your fingertips, making it easy to explore the sonic worlds inside
each Performance. Tweaking an existing sound? Quickly identify modulation sources using real-time displays of all
envelopes, LFOs, and other primary modulation sources. Easily create modulation routings using drag-and-drop,
and get an overview of all routings via the Mod List. Mod Processors let you transform modulation signals using
quantization, smoothing, curvature, and more.
Layers and Effects
For even more rich and complex results, layer two Programs together in a Performance–each with their own effects and
arpeggiator. modwave native’s superb effects deliver production-ready sounds. Each Layer has three dedicated effects
(Pre, Mod, and Delay); additionally, the Performance has a Master Reverb and Master EQ.
Presets and Randomization
modwave native comes with about 250 factory Performances, and many more Programs, Wavetables, and Effects
Presets. Smooth Sound Transitions let previously-played voices and effects ring out naturally when you change sounds.
Looking for even more inspiration? The “dice” icon at the top of the window generates new sounds via intelligent
randomization. Randomize the entire sound or just a part of it, such as the filter, motion sequence, or effects. Use the
results directly, or as a jumping-off point for your own creations.
